A growing geospatial solutions company in Godalming seeks a Senior Geomatics Surveyor who is ambitious and ready to progress to Survey Manager. This role offers ownership of geospatial survey projects, contributing to department growth while mentoring future surveyors. Ideal candidates have strong technical skills in surveying technologies and a proactive approach. Benefits include a competitive salary, pension, life assurance, and genuine career advancement opportunities.
